有时候需要判断逻辑再弹出View,这样子的话就不能直接通过按钮的Segue来弹出,就需要添加代码来控制segue。此时segue的添加(那个箭头),需要在viewcontroller之间建立。需要注意的是!源viewcontroller需要在左侧栏右击!给segue添加好id,直接用这一句话可以搞定。[selfperf..
分类:
移动开发 时间:
2016-05-13 05:16:40
阅读次数:
236
//——————————————— 在不确定的Segue跳转 多个按钮指向要跳转的视图 1、在一个恰当的位置执行跳转 - (IBAction)addHero:(id)sender { NSEntityDescription *entity=self.fetchedResultsController. ...
分类:
其他好文 时间:
2016-04-29 00:18:46
阅读次数:
136
1、传值问题:为什么不能给控件的接口赋值 如执行Segue跳转 [self performSegueWithIdentifier:GAPlayeVideo sender:gaVideo]; //在跳转到目标界面前,给目标对象传递参数 - (void)prepareForSegue:(UIStoryb ...
分类:
其他好文 时间:
2016-04-29 00:14:55
阅读次数:
175
1. 拖线 按住Control键,用鼠标从源控制器的某个控件开始,拖动到目的控制器 2. 选择弹出类型并设置Segue Identifier 在弹出的对话框中,选择“Selection Segue->Show” 见下图 设置Segue Identifier 3. 在目的视图控制器中设置接收桩 4. ...
分类:
移动开发 时间:
2016-04-13 13:12:23
阅读次数:
143
一、block与方法的异同点: 相同点是都是保存代码段,什么时候执行,什么时候调用 不同点是block不受类或者对象的约束;方法收到了类或者对象的约束 二、思路:(通讯录练习) 在联系人控制器中,添加完联系人或者修改完后保存联系人的时候需要刷新联系人控制器的tableView 但是,联系人控制器中不 ...
分类:
移动开发 时间:
2016-03-27 23:43:08
阅读次数:
210
//当页面跳转时系统自动调用,segue连线 - (void)prepareForSegue:(UIStoryboardSegue *)segue sender:(id)sender {} segue.sourceViewController 现有界面 segue.destinationViewCo
分类:
移动开发 时间:
2016-03-13 14:22:21
阅读次数:
173
通过segue传值 在storyboard设置segue的Identifier segue是连接两个视图控制器交互的线 sender是触发这个方法执行的对象,比如是单击tableView上的cell跳到下一界面 那么这个cell就是sender //此方法在表视图控制器.m文件中最下面- (void
分类:
其他好文 时间:
2016-03-11 22:08:22
阅读次数:
203
1、UITextAlignment ---> NSTextAlignment 2、找不到segue viewcontroller 与segue要对应 3、标题栏用NavigationControler + ViewController 4、如果模拟器不可运行,而真机可以运行,可能是库的require
分类:
移动开发 时间:
2016-03-07 22:16:36
阅读次数:
216
方式一:Storyboard的segues方式 鼠标点击按钮button然后按住control键拖拽到SVC页面,在弹出的segue页面中选择跳转模式即可 优点:操作方便,无代码生成,在storyboard中展示逻辑清晰缺点:页面较多时不方便查看,团队合作时可维护性差, 多人合作时不建议使用这种方式
分类:
移动开发 时间:
2016-02-26 12:16:41
阅读次数:
209
大熊猫猪·侯佩原创或翻译作品.欢迎转载,转载请注明出处.
如果觉得写的不好请多提意见,如果觉得不错请多多支持点赞.谢谢! hopy ;)
首先推荐大家看这本书,整本书逻辑非常清晰,代码如何从无到有,到丰满说的很有调理.说实话本书到目前为止错误还是极少的,不过人无完人,在第14章前半部分项目的代码中,作者在MasterVC到DetailVC中又直接添加了一个segue,该segue的ID为”ma...
分类:
移动开发 时间:
2016-02-26 07:00:10
阅读次数:
233